V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
Leslie5205912
V2EX  ›  宽带症候群

不理解为什么 smb 直接公网 ip 连接下载还没 frp 快

  •  
  •   Leslie5205912 · 2023-03-10 14:16:34 +08:00 · 3280 次点击
    这是一个创建于 657 天前的主题,其中的信息可能已经有所发展或是发生改变。
    下午在用 nplayer 下电影
    家里 100M 电信 esxi 虚拟化的 win10 自带的 smb 共享 443 端口
    通过 tplink 提供的 ddns 连接 速度 300-500kb
    通过 frp 连接 400-600kb
    速率可能不太严格但是肉眼可见就是慢
    理论上 frp 多中转了一次不是更慢吗
    16 条回复    2023-03-14 09:18:54 +08:00
    rojer12
        1
    rojer12  
       2023-03-10 14:24:53 +08:00   ❤️ 3
    试试 webdav ,感觉比 smb 块,可以试试这个轻量化的小软件
    https://github.com/docblue/chfsgui
    Leslie5205912
        2
    Leslie5205912  
    OP
       2023-03-10 14:29:48 +08:00
    @rojer12 多谢 我试下
    Leslie5205912
        3
    Leslie5205912  
    OP
       2023-03-10 14:57:13 +08:00
    @rojer12 龟龟 一开始也还是 500kb 后面飙到 2mb 了 你是我的神
    rojer12
        4
    rojer12  
       2023-03-10 15:13:59 +08:00   ❤️ 1
    @Leslie5205912 #3
    安卓 cx file 文件管理器挂载 webdav ,在外面基本秒开
    blueboyggh
        5
    blueboyggh  
       2023-03-10 15:44:48 +08:00 via Android
    @rojer12 好像好久不更新了?
    rojer12
        6
    rojer12  
       2023-03-10 16:06:57 +08:00
    @blueboyggh #5 能用就行。。。俺也不是作者,比自己开 iis 搭 webdav 方便多了
    angeltop
        7
    angeltop  
       2023-03-10 17:26:27 +08:00   ❤️ 1
    MeteorVIP
        8
    MeteorVIP  
       2023-03-10 19:45:25 +08:00 via iPhone
    @rojer12 #1 我测试了一下,webdav 速度 4m/s 确实比 smb 的 2m/s 快。两个都是用 nplayer 局域网下载,做对比。
    systemcall
        9
    systemcall  
       2023-03-10 19:56:17 +08:00
    可能是运营商做了限速
    smb 容易传播病毒,运营商很多时候都会检测 smb 相关的东西,再就是 smb 有时候会通过 netbios 来查找 IP ,再来建立连接,会使用它觉得好的 IP
    dann73580
        10
    dann73580  
       2023-03-11 01:47:13 +08:00
    用 webdav ,同时开启宿主机 bbr 优化下上传~
    martinMao
        11
    martinMao  
       2023-03-11 06:50:11 +08:00 via iPhone
    反正我在局域网里面测试。ftp 比 smb 要快。
    wizardyhnr
        12
    wizardyhnr  
       2023-03-11 09:02:21 +08:00
    SMB1:SMB1 (也称为 CIFS )自 Windows NT 发布以来得到支持。
    SMB2:SMB2 自从 Windows Vista 发布以来得到支持,且为 SMB 的增强版本。SMB2 增加了将多重 SMB 操作功能组合到单个请求的功能,以减少网络数据包的数量并提高性能。
    SMB2 和 Large MTU:最大传输单元 (MTU) 是指可通过通讯协议的最大数据单元。为利用最快的更快的接口,如 1- 或 10-gigabit 以太网,Large MTU 将最大传输单元提高至 1 megabyte (MB)。启用 Large MTU 可提高大文件传输的速度和效率,同时降低需处理的数据包数量。
    SMB3:SMB3 自 Windows 8 和 Windows Server 2012 发布以来得到支持。它是 SMB 2 的增强版。SMB3 支持基于 AES 的文件加密传输,从而提高了对等文件传输的安全性。

    Win10 共享好像默认是 128 位加密的,你比比 sftp 和 ftp 的速度就知道了。加密速度会慢。
    dude4
        13
    dude4  
       2023-03-11 21:01:19 +08:00
    FTP 不加密纯明文,速度肯定比加密的 smb 要快
    外网就别用了,即使是不重要的媒体文件,被人嗅探到暴力破解也浪费你的服务器资源
    samba 防火墙打洞端口太多,直接开放不方便,默认端口 ISP 有 QOS 限速,你改端口,大部分客户端软件不支持非默认端口,又失去了 smb 易用兼容的特点,所以一般都是挂 VPN 建造局域网环境来用 samba ,但是如果包裹的 VPN 是 UDP ,譬如 wireguard ,就会因为壳子被 ISP 检测到而 QOS 受影响
    外网追求速度的文件共享还是 LS 说的 webdav ,亲测可以跑满家宽上传
    Orzpls
        14
    Orzpls  
       2023-03-12 04:01:33 +08:00 via Android
    UDP 和 TCP 的 QoS 区别。
    Leslie5205912
        15
    Leslie5205912  
    OP
       2023-03-14 09:12:29 +08:00
    @angeltop 多谢!
    Leslie5205912
        16
    Leslie5205912  
    OP
       2023-03-14 09:18:54 +08:00
    @martinMao frp 啦 nplayer 的话我测试是在线看 ftp 快 下载速度 smb 快 在线看好像是 nplayer smb 的转码问题
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   5859 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 24ms · UTC 02:22 · PVG 10:22 · LAX 18:22 · JFK 21:22
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.